Manx Telecom is now supporting leading children's play charity Isle of Play.
The charity runs multiple projects to give children the freedom to explore through play and reclaim their childhood.
It relies on grants, sponsorship and donations to run and will be launching two fundraising drives in the autumn for individuals and businesses to donate.
Isle of Play founder Chris Gregory says staff at Manx Telecom have always been great supporters to them through various 'Giving Back' schemes, and they're excited to now agree a formal sponsorship agreement.
